Grosnez Castle, a captivating historical site on the picturesque island of Jersey, invites tourists to explore its ancient ruins and stunning coastal views. This medieval fortress, perched atop a dramatic cliff, not only showcases the island's tumultuous past but also offers a breathtaking backdrop for photography and leisurely walks. A must-visit for history enthusiasts and nature lovers alike.

Local tips
- Visit during sunrise or sunset for the best lighting and fewer crowds.
- Wear comfortable shoes, as the terrain can be uneven and the walk requires some effort.
- Bring a camera to capture the breathtaking views and the castle's ancient architecture.
- Pack a picnic to enjoy while taking in the stunning coastal scenery.
